SECTION 57
Establishment and organization
Executive (EXC) CHAPTER 18, ARTICLE 4-B
§ 57. Establishment and organization. 1. There shall be an office of
the inspector general of New York for transportation in the executive
department. The head of the office shall be the inspector general of New
York for transportation.

2. The inspector general shall be appointed by the governor and shall
hold office until the end of the term of the governor by whom he or she
is appointed and until his or her successor is appointed.

3. The inspector general may appoint a deputy inspector general to
serve at his or her pleasure, who shall be responsible for conducting
investigations and prosecuting violations of law. The inspector general
shall identify a process for a coordinated approach with prosecutors to
avoid duplication and provide for a timely response to alleged
violations.

4. The salary of the inspector general shall be established by the
governor within the limit of funds available therefore.
